This four-panel floral collage captures the story of a coordinated wedding collection in soft, romantic tones, ideal for a stylish ceremony or reception around Notting Hill's tree-lined streets. The upper-left frame draws the eye to a bride in a lace wedding dress, seen from the waist down, holding a round, compact bouquet that almost fills her hands. Light pink and lilac-tinged roses, some tightly furled, others fully opened, mingle with vivid green button chrysanthemums, pale pink alstroemeria flecked with golden specks, delicate white baby's breath, and fresh green leaves, creating a tapestry of petal and texture. In the upper-right image, the camera closes in on a charcoal grey suit and rich fuchsia tie, where a boutonniere rests securely on the lapel. It pairs a single blush pink rosebud with bright green button chrysanthemums, wisps of gypsophila, and fine strands of decorative grass, all tied with a slim pink ribbon that harmonises with the bride's bouquet. The lower-left scene shows a similar bouquet lying on a neutral beige fabric surface, offering a clear view of the flower heads and the stems carefully wrapped in a fuchsia satin ribbon, hinting at the craftsmanship behind the design. In the lower-right panel, a low, rounded centerpiece sits on a white surface: a nest of pink and lavender roses, lively green chrysanthemums, pink alstroemeria, and baby's breath spilling from a decorative white woven-look sphere, flanked by two smaller pale orbs. Together, the four images suggest how a single floral theme can be carried gracefully from aisle to lapel to table, perfect for a relaxed yet polished Notting Hill wedding. Celebrate your special day with the Sincerely Yours Wedding Collection from Flowers Notting Hill, expertly designed for elegant weddings in Notting Hill and across London. This premium wedding flower package features beautifully coordinated bridal and bridesmaid bouquets plus groom and groomsmen boutonnieres, crafted with fresh, fragrant blooms for a timeless, romantic look.

Choose from three tailored options to suit your guest list and budget: the Intimate Package for 50-75 guests, the Original Package for 75-100 guests, or the Ultimate Package for 100+ guests. Each collection includes one stunning bridal bouquet as the focal point, complemented by multiple bridesmaid bouquets and matching groom's boutonnieres for a cohesive, photo-ready finish.
